Output ef6c99486d2bd697865df89bc4f259ec7f66a6530e1d98e8ee4fc692b4fa9612:0

value
3706436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313dd0a520bfd3c1475a8e8325e0abf7048e1abe OP_EQUAL
address
36BP5vgM4GYbfEtKeX4sUjFrkyXxdjGAWr
transaction
ef6c99486d2bd697865df89bc4f259ec7f66a6530e1d98e8ee4fc692b4fa9612
spent
true